What is the Order of Operations?
The order of operations is a set of rules that dictates the correct sequence to evaluate a mathematical expression. Without a standardized approach, expressions like 3 + 4 × 2 could yield different results depending on how the operations are performed. The widely accepted convention is Parentheses, Exponents, Multiplication and Division (from left to right), and Addition and Subtraction (from left to right), often remembered by the acronym PEMDAS.
